Before You Begin Assembly
The following safety hazards may result in serious injury or death:
· This product contains small parts. Keep children away during assembly. Make sure to
remove all packaging material and parts from underneath the vehicle body.
· Never open the battery. Batteries contain lead and lead compounds (acids) that are toxic
and corrosive, and known to the state of California to cause cancer and reproductive
harm.
· Limbs, hair, and clothing can get caught in moving parts. Always wear shoes, keep limbs
away from moving parts, and do not wear loose clothing while operating this vehicle.
· This Vehicle does not have brakes or braking capability. Do not leave a child unattended
during operation. Do not use this in a location that may require braking capability, as this
could result in loss of control, which may cause serious injury or death.
· Use of this vehicle in unsafe conditions such as snow, rain, loose dirt, mud, sand, or
gravel may result in an unexpected accident such as tipping over, and could damage the
electrical system or battery.
· Do not operate this vehicle in an unsafe manner. Examples include but are not limited to:
- Pulling the vehicle with another vehicle or similar device
- Allowing more than one rider
- Pushing the user
- Traveling at an unsafe speed

Before You Begin Assembly
The following safety hazards may result in serious injury or death:
· Use of a battery charger other than the supplied 12V rechargeable battery and charger
may cause a re or explosion. Only use the supplied battery and charger.
· Use of the 12V rechargeable battery and charger for any other product may result in
overheating, re, or explosion. Never use the supplied rechargeable battery and charger
with another product.
· Explosive gases are created during charging. Charge the battery in a well-ventilated area.
Do not charge the battery near heat or ammable materials.
· Contact between the positive and negative terminals may result in re or explosion. Avoid
direct contact between the terminals. Picking up the battery by the wires or charger can
cause damage to the battery and may result in a re. Always pick up the battery by its
case or handles.
· Liquids on the battery may cause re or electric shock. Always keep all liquids away from
the battery and keep the battery dry. Contact or exposure to battery leakage (lead acid)
may cause serious injury. If contact or exposure occurs immediately call your physician.
If the chemical is on the skin or in the eyes, ush with cool water for 15 minutes. If the
chemical was swallowed, immediately give the person water or milk. Do not give water or
milk if the patient is vomiting or has a decreased level of alertness. Do not induce vomiting.
· Battery posts, terminals, and related accessories contain lead and lead compounds (acid)
- chemicals known to the state of California to cause cancer, reproductive harm, and are
toxic and corrosive. Never open the battery.
· Tampering or modifying the electric circuit system may cause a shock , re or explosion
and permanently damage the system. Exposed wiring and circuitry in the charger may
cause electric shock. Always keep the charger housing closed.

Attach the Front Wheels
1. Slide a Ø12 washer (3) onto the front axle.
2. Slide the bushing (4) (ring end rst) onto the front axle.
3. Slide the front wheel (5) onto the front axle. And keep the front wheel (5)
match with the bushing.
4. Slide a Ø12 washer (3) onto the front axle.
5. Tighten a lock nut (24) to the end of the front axle with a spanner.
6. “Snap” the hubcap (8) to the wheel cover.
- Repeat the above procedure to assemble the other front wheel. -
GAP
After assembling any wheel to the axles, please check the
gap between the screw thread and the collapsible (refer to
below picture), if the gap is too big, please add two or three
washers inside the wheel, but after tightening the nut outside
the wheel, please turn the wheel by your nger to check if the
wheel can run smoothly, this is very important, because if the
wheel can run smoothly, it is ok, but if the nut press the wheel
and the wheel can’t run smoothly, the motor will be broken
easily! Then you need to decrease one or two washers to make
sure the wheel can run smoothly!
